    My husband's documents were dq on Oct 7th. Has anyone gotten an interview letter from Oct 1st to Oct 10th? 

    My DQ is Oct 28th so I don't know. The embassy sends out Interview Letters 20th - 24th of every month for the next month. You can join the group mentioned above to see but as of 20th August 2021, DQ cases until 9th September 2020 were scheduled for the month of September 2021. Interview Letters for October 2021 have not been sent out yet so we will see which dates they cover. Most likely they will only cover remaining 3 weeks of DQ'd cases from September 2020. Based on that timeline, your case could be scheduled for Interview in November or December but this is all just speculation.

  7. Hi All, 

     

    My wife sponsored me for an IR-1 visa back in 2019. My case became Documentarily Qualified on October 28th 2020 and is pending Interview at the US Consulate in Islamabad, Pakistan. I understand there is a backlog of cases everywhere, is there a way to find out which month of DQ'd cases the Islamabad Consulate is processing right now? Alternatively, members here at Visa Journey who have recently had immigration interviews at the US Consulate in Islamabad, when were your respective cases Documentarily Qualified? I am trying to get an idea of when I could realistically have my interview scheduled.
